Whoopi Goldberg chose to sit out from The View today in order to check-in with her doctor.
The 64-year-old host wants to make sure if’s safe for her to return to the show amid the coronavirus pandemic.
“To be extra careful about her health, Whoopi is consulting with her doctor today,” co-host Sunny Hostin explained on Tuesday (March 17). “She wants everyone to know she feels fine and plans on being back here tomorrow.”

Whoopi Goldberg was a no-show on her U.S. daytime talk show The View on Tuesday after taking a break to visit her doctor.
After a life-threatening battle with pneumonia in 2019, Whoopi Goldberg made the decision to visit her doctor and see if continuing to host The View amid the global coronavirus pandemic will endanger her health. Whoopi, 64, was absent from the March 17 episode of The View, and co-host Sunny Hostin explained at the top of the show what was going on.
